Elton John, Demi Moore and Salma Hayek will host the Golden Globes

Elton John, Demi Moore and Salma Hayek There will be some of the celebrities who will present their awards at the next edition Golden Globe It will take place on January 5 Beverly Hilton Los Angelesthe organization announced this Thursday.

John, Moore and Hayek are accompanied by actors such as Vin Diesel, Andrew Garfield, Anthony Mackie, Anthony Ramos, Dwayne Johnson, Anya Taylor-Joy, Ariana DeBose and Aubrey Plaza.

Likewise the two-time Golden Globe winner Colin Farrellaward-winning actress Glenn CloseVenezuelan Edgar Ramírez and actresses Kate Hudson, Michelle Yeoh, Viola Davis and Margaret QualleyHe also stands out in the list, which brings together more than 40 personalities.

The 82nd Golden Globe Awards will air live on CBS and will also be available to stream on Paramount+.

The Cecil B. DeMille Award, which recognizes lifetime achievement in film, will be given to Viola Davis, and the Carol Burnett Award, which recognizes outstanding contributions to television on and off the screen, will be given to Ted Danson.
